Volvo is a global automotive manufacturer of luxury vehicles that prides itself on safety and safety technologies. The Volvo brand builds sedans and crossovers, and even offers performance vehicles through its Polestar tuning division.
Volvo is known for its well-engineered products, and it shows in the brand's reliability. Each Volvo does require regularly scheduled vehicle maintenance, such as oil changes and tire rotations, but some problems can arise depending on the model and year of the vehicle. Those problems include engine and transmission issues.
